G. Clifford Carter (M'70, SM'78, F'88) was born and raised in Oak Park, IL. He is a 1967 graduate of the U.S. Coast Guard Academy. He earned the M.S.E.E. and Ph.D.E.E. degrees from the University of Connecticut in 1972 and 1976.Dr. Carter is an electronics engineer at NUWC (formerly NUSC), New London, CT and an adjunct Professor at the University of Connecticut at Storrs. He teaches graduate level courses in digital signal processing, detection, estimation, and communications theory. He has lectured throughout the U.S., Canada, and Europe and is an internationally recognized expert in signal processing. He has served on Ph.D. committees at the University of Connecticut, Kansas State University, University of Saskatchewan in Saskatoon, Brown University, and Instituto Superior Tecnico in Portugal.
In addition to his technical expertise, Dr. Carter is an experienced technical manager. He is the recipient of numerous awards for his line and program management accomplishments including organizational and program growth, getting signal processing algorithms to sea for testing and development of cooperative ventures with industry. He served in Washington, at the Office of Naval Research, Technology Directorate, (formerly the Office of Naval Technology), where he was the program element-technical area manager for the U.S. Navy's ocean and undersea applied research programs. Dr. Carter is a Fellow of the IEEE, coauthor of the 1993 CRC Electrical Engineering Handbook and the editor of an IEEE Press book: Coherence and Time Delay Estimation.
